Aim: To investigate the chemical constituents of water-soluble part of stem of Nauclea officinalis.
Methods: The compounds were isolated and purified by resins, silica gel, and Sephadex LH20 column chromatography repeatedly, and their structures were identified by spectral analysis.
Results: Seven compounds were isolated and identified as: naucleamide A-10-O-beta-D-glucopyranoside (I), 5-beta-carboxystrictosidin (II), sweroside (III), loganin (IV), 3,4-dimethoxyphenyl-beta-D-glucopyranoside (V), 3, 4, 5-trimethoxyphenyl-beta-D-glucopyranoside (VI), 2-phenethylrutinoside (VII).
Conclusion: Compound I is a new indole alkaloid glucoside, compounds I-VII were isolated from this plant for the first time.
